it won't work on a MAC.. the auto-updater program that the inTune has is a Windows-only program... It will only run on a Windows PC/laptop...

you will have to contact [email protected] and let them know you have a MAC, and that you want the latest intune updates... they will get you the files and you will have to update your intune manually, by copying the update files, one by one, to the inTune drive...

mikel wrote:If you dont have 1r03y, you must load that before 1r04d

to see the current versions, go to settings/tool info/firmware info
